2011-11-05 2 views
2

컬렉션에 추가 이벤트를 여러 번 바인딩 할 수 있습니까? 이벤트가 발생할 때 여러 함수를 호출하고 싶습니다. (여러 뷰에서 동일한 컬렉션을 가지고 있으므로 요소를 추가 할 때 모든 뷰의 addview 함수가 실행되기를 원합니다.) 이제는 마지막 뷰를 호출 한 뷰를 호출하는 것입니다.백본의 동일한 이벤트에 여러 함수 바인딩

답변

3

예, 여러 바인딩 하나의 이벤트.

당신이 있다면 :

this.model.bind('add', this.add); 
this.model.bind('add', this.add2); 

모두 추가하고 추가 이벤트가 발생하는 경우 ADD2가 실행됩니다.

+0

새보기를 만들 때 기존 컬렉션을 덮어 쓰는 새 컬렉션을 만들었으므로 바인딩이 보존되지 않았습니다. – IgorT

관련 문제